Akron 39, W. Michigan 38

Associated Press

Saturday, October 6, 2007

KALAMAZOO, Mich. (AP) -- Andre Jones and Alphonso Owen combined on an 89-yard kick return on the game's final play, giving Akron a 39-38 victory over Western Michigan on Saturday night. Western Michigan (2-4, 1-1 Mid-American) led 38-31 with 15 seconds left when Jamarko Simmons ran out of the end zone on a fourth-down designed safety, cutting the Broncos' lead to 38-33.
